The Pre-Legal Collection Specialist plays a critical role in recovering delinquent accounts by serving as a bridge between the collections and legal departments. This position is responsible for managing accounts that have not responded to standard collection efforts and may be candidates for legal escalation. Primary Responsibilities Communicate with customers regarding accounts receivable and collection matters professionally and promptly. Communicate and follow up effectively with customers and branch personnel. Resolve customer disputes related to outstanding balances using strong negotiation and persuasive communication skills. Conduct risk assessments. Coordinate and document payment arrangements with customers. Handle a high volume of outgoing collection calls to assigned delinquent accounts. Handle incoming calls from customers and internal branches, resolving inquiries and payment issues. Establish and maintain effective working relationships with internal teams and co-workers. Meet individual portfolio, departmental, and company collection goals. Monitor and report on key performance metrics for accounts within their scope of responsibility.
